TEN-YEAR-OLD Ethan Ferguson of Buccoo, Tobago has made his family and community proud with his outstanding performance in the 2026 Secondary Entrance Assessment (SEA) examination, sitting the examination while he was in Standard Four and passing for his first choice.
Ethan sat the SEA examination privately after expressing a desire to write the examination alongside his older sister, Amelia, who was preparing for it. Believing he was academically ready, his parents, Mai Ferguson (a Tatil Life financial advisor) and Dr Ferguson made the decision to register both children privately for the 2026 SEA examination.
The school choices were Scarborough Secondary School, Bishop's High School and Signal Hill Secondary School.
